Prokaryotic:
Contain DNA - found in the cytoplasm as no nucleus present
Are surrounded by a cell membrane - no other double-membrane bound organelle present
Were the first photosynthetic organisms on Earth - cyanobacteria
Eukaryotic:
Contain DNA - present inside the nucleus
Are surrounded by a cell membrane - double-membrane organelle present
Can be specialized for specific tasks in multicellular organisms
contain nuclei - a central organelle present that separates genetic material from the cytoplasm.
